Find slope if a line pass through the original and (3,2)

heyy im not sure if you meant origin instead of original but the origin would be (0,0)

Answer:

2/3

Step-by-step explanation:

the slope form equation is :  y2 - y1/ x2-x1 (aka change in y divided by change in x)

so it would be  2-0/ 3-0 = 2/3

the slope is 2/3
